Description | β-Phellandrene (p-mentha-1(7),2-diene) is found in allspice. beta-Phellandrene is widely distributed in essential oils |
Synonyms | beta-Phellandrene, 3-异丙基-6-亚甲基-1-环己烯, p-mentha-1(7),2-diene, (±)-beta-水芹烯 |
molecular weight | 136.23 |
Molecular formula | C10H16 |
CAS | 555-10-2 |
